LivCor, a Blackstone portfolio company, is a real estate asset management business specializing in multi-family housing. Formed in 2013 and headquartered in Chicago, LivCor is currently responsible for a portfolio of over 400 Class A and B properties comprising more than 150,000 units in markets across the United States.

We are looking for a Director of Portfolio Insights – Reporting who will be responsible for analyzing and communicating key operating and performance trends to both senior LivCor leadership teams and to Blackstone Asset Management. This leader will play a critical role in the design, development and enhancement of LivCor’s operational and financial reporting processes. This position will support a team of up 5 members located both domestically and off-shore, and will oversee multiple workstreams, requiring a process improvement mindset, strong attention to detail and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ment.

What you will do:

  • Serve as a primary point of contact between LivCor and Blackstone for Insight workflows, providing timely and accurate responses to questions and requests for information
  • Own the preparation and distribution of portfolio performance reports, including current leasing trends and monthly operating reports
  • Assist with the preparation and creation of quarterly Board materials
  • Deliver ad hoc analyses to LivCor asset management and Blackstone, with a high level of attention to detail
  • Measure and analyze the performance of company KPI’s, provide insights into drivers of company performance
  • Ensure that all reports are accurate, consistent, and delivered in a timely manner
  • Utilize data analytics and reporting tools to extract insights from LivCor’s operating data and market trends
  • Develop understanding and familiarity with sourcing of data from various research and industry data publications including the RealPage suite of products (YieldStar, Performance Analytics, Market Analytics, Axiometrics, MPF), Green Street Advisors, Real Capital Analytics, Bureau of Labor Statistics, Census, etc
  • Compare LivCor performance to the public multifamily REITs and present results at a company and market level to the executive leadership team
  • Foster strong working relationships and collaborate with cross-functional teams across LivCor with a focus of driving operational performance through enhanced reporting tools
  • Vigilantly and proactively participate in a continual process improvement initiative. Develop processes that save time (automate) while maintaining the highest quality standards
  • Coach and develop team members, providing real-time and formal feedback

What you should have:

  • Minimum of 10 years finance or investor relations experience
  • Minimum of 5 years successfully managing and mentoring a team
  • Bachelor's degree
  • Proven experience in a similar investor relations or reporting role, preferably in the real estate industry or a related field
  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ail, with the ability to manage multiple deadlines and workstreams simultaneously
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with stakeholders at all levels of the organization
  • Proactive and self-motivated, with the ability to work independently and drive projects to completion.
